Concerning screening Water samples are checked in a lab for a team of bacteria called Enterococci. Enterococci are commonly located in the belly of warm-blooded animals and human beings. High degrees of these bacteria can aid indicate a decrease in water high quality for swimmers. Enterococci are not unsafe themselves, they can show the possible presence of harmful bacteria such as microorganisms, infections and protozoa.

g. lakes, rivers etc are likewise tested for another team of microorganisms called Escherichia coli (E. coli). This team of microorganisms is also commonly found in the tummy of warm-blooded animals and human beings, and they are a great indicator of faecal contamination in water. E. coli tend to die-off rapidly in progressively brackish waters and are for that reason not a good indicator for aquatic waters.

A general germs test considers the general number of microorganisms present in the water that are able to grow. This is referred to as a total viable matter (TVC). Overall practical count (TVC) is a test that approximates the complete numbers of microbes, such as microorganisms, yeast or mould varieties, that exist in a water sample.

The Basic Principles Of Bacteria Testing

The results of a TVC examination offer an indicator into the basic degree of contamination within a system and the total quality of the water. While TVC approximates the number of sensible or real-time cells that can growing right into distinct swarms, the overall bacteria count (TBC) identifies the matter of all cells both dead and active.

The samples may be bred at different temperature levels depending on the atmosphere being experienced. Samples from a drinking water system must be incubated at 22C or 37C for 24 hours in accordance with BS EN ISO 6222. At 22C, the TVC suggests the number of online microorganisms per ml of water at ambient temperature, suggesting the matter will predominantly be composed of safe bacteria.



Examples extracted from cooling tower systems, on the other hand, ought to be incubated at 30C in accordance with ACo, P L8, HSG 274 Component 1. These test problems are set to isolate the array of microorganisms that can colonize and cause infections. As a result of the varied variety of microorganisms that can be discovered, testing for TVC is described as non-selective.

There is no strict regulation on the acceptable worth for TVC in drinking water. The guide restrictions for bacterial degrees are that there must be "no considerable rise" from the inbound mains supply. What's most crucial is being able to recognize any irregularities. This is why it may be advised that TVC screening is accomplished routinely, to ensure that businesses can understand baseline contamination levels and determine any type of significant discrepancy from the standard when it occurs.

Microbial growth in biofilms may lead to damage of water quality as well as negative preferences and odours. Companies have see this here a responsibility of treatment to guarantee their water systems are effectively protected and safe for customers.

Evaluating TVC on a regular basis enables companies to understand standard contamination degrees and determine any type of considerable discrepancy from the baseline. When a variance occurs, it may suggest the requirement for additional investigation and might indicate troubles in a system. TVC testing can also be utilized to assess the performance of the water treatment routine.

The Main Principles Of Bacteria Testing

A matter of 50 cfu/ml obtained one month complied with a count of 60 cfu/ml the next month would certainly not be considered significant. A count of 50 one month adhered to by a count of 5000 the following month may be considered a substantial change to the system. It isn't unusual to discover seasonal variants.

With appropriate surveillance and control for TVC in water, the chance of finding a substantial deviation is low. Eventually, there is no alternative for great engineering, risk evaluation and a durable water management strategy.
